Our Culture
At Engineering Good (EG), we are a community of tenacious problem-solvers. We see barriers as engineering challenges waiting for a creative fix. We move fast to narrow the digital divide, driven by the belief that technology should empower everyone, regardless of background.
But don’t let the casual vibes fool you; we take our mission and our stewardship of public trust very seriously. We’re looking for people who want to "do good and be better" every single day.
Mission First, Always
Our "North Star" is the well-being of our beneficiaries. Whether we are refurbishing a laptop or prototyping a new assistive tool, every action we take is indexed on the meaningful impact it creates for the community.
Standing on the Shoulders of Giants
We practice "Humility and Collaboration." We take pride in our work, but we know we’re building on the efforts of the volunteers and staff who came before us.
We stand on the shoulders of giants to build "better-er" things for the future.

Empathy is Our Default Setting
We work with diverse groups, from students to seniors to persons with disabilities. We value "diversity and empathy" because understanding someone else's lived experience is the first step to building a solution that actually works.
Kaypoh for Good
We are naturally curious (or as we say in Singapore, a bit kaypoh). We’re forward-leaning because we want to get things done effectively.
We don't tiptoe around problems; we dive into them to find the most sustainable way forward.
Open Hearts and Honest Talk
We encourage open-mindedness and respectful discussions. You can debate tech, politics, or the best way to solder a circuit, as long as you treat everyone with dignity.
We’re a "no surprises" kind of team; we share feedback candidly because that’s how we grow.
